From 2d93f1ed61a260d2373f606fa14feaf273a562fb Mon Sep 17 00:00:00 2001 From: Laurent Cans Date: Tue, 2 Oct 2018 21:53:01 +0200 Subject: [PATCH] aircrack-ng: bump to version 1.4 - Remove patch (already in version) - align LICENSE hash to minor modifications in file Signed-off-by: Laurent Cans Tested-by: Matt Weber Signed-off-by: Peter Korsgaard --- .../aircrack-ng/0001-Fix-build-with-mmx.patch | 71 ------------------- ...otools-Fix-optional-SIMD-on-PPC-arch.patch | 69 ------------------ package/aircrack-ng/aircrack-ng.hash | 6 +- package/aircrack-ng/aircrack-ng.mk | 2 +- 4 files changed, 4 insertions(+), 144 deletions(-) delete mode 100644 package/aircrack-ng/0001-Fix-build-with-mmx.patch delete mode 100644 package/aircrack-ng/0001-autotools-Fix-optional-SIMD-on-PPC-arch.patch diff --git a/package/aircrack-ng/0001-Fix-build-with-mmx.patch b/package/aircrack-ng/0001-Fix-build-with-mmx.patch deleted file mode 100644 index 620d806d88..0000000000 --- a/package/aircrack-ng/0001-Fix-build-with-mmx.patch +++ /dev/null @@ -1,71 +0,0 @@ -From 37078a46346f01141cc13026bb5ad426bb98f3a0 Mon Sep 17 00:00:00 2001 -From: Fabrice Fontaine -Date: Wed, 22 Aug 2018 20:01:07 +0200 -Subject: [PATCH] Fix build with mmx - -Commit 39387fc80f90f3a9ac9ef9f3aa32da5776a0721e removed mmx support -however aircrack-ng fails to build on platforms with mmx because an -error is raised if __MMX__ is defined. - -Fixes: - - http://autobuild.buildroot.net/results/b7362b69435e9ef6fb2aedc50743e88dbd7a5c72 - -Signed-off-by: Fabrice Fontaine -[Upstream status: merged (https://github.com/aircrack-ng/aircrack-ng/pull/1943)] ---- - src/aircrack-crypto/arch.h | 3 --- - src/aircrack-crypto/memory.h | 3 --- - src/aircrack-crypto/pseudo_intrinsics.h | 9 --------- - 3 files changed, 15 deletions(-) - -diff --git a/src/aircrack-crypto/arch.h b/src/aircrack-crypto/arch.h -index 1a19ddd6..78b9e619 100644 ---- a/src/aircrack-crypto/arch.h -+++ b/src/aircrack-crypto/arch.h -@@ -357,9 +357,6 @@ - #elif __SSE2__ - #define SIMD_COEF_32 4 - #define SIMD_COEF_64 2 --#elif __MMX__ --#define SIMD_COEF_32 2 --#define SIMD_COEF_64 1 - #endif - - /* -diff --git a/src/aircrack-crypto/memory.h b/src/aircrack-crypto/memory.h -index 83b048f0..24b1c95b 100644 ---- a/src/aircrack-crypto/memory.h -+++ b/src/aircrack-crypto/memory.h -@@ -70,9 +70,6 @@ - #elif __SSE2__ - #define SIMD_COEF_32 4 - #define SIMD_COEF_64 2 --#elif __MMX__ --#define SIMD_COEF_32 2 --#define SIMD_COEF_64 1 - #endif - - /* -diff --git a/src/aircrack-crypto/pseudo_intrinsics.h b/src/aircrack-crypto/pseudo_intrinsics.h -index dd0ca379..f5527bdd 100644 ---- a/src/aircrack-crypto/pseudo_intrinsics.h -+++ b/src/aircrack-crypto/pseudo_intrinsics.h -@@ -658,15 +658,6 @@ _inline __m128i _mm_set1_epi64(long long a) - (vtype)(vtype64) { x0, x1 } - #endif - --/******************************** MMX *********************************/ -- --#elif __MMX__ --#include -- --typedef __m64i vtype; -- --#error MMX intrinsics not implemented (contributions are welcome!) -- - #endif /* __SIMD__ elif __SIMD__ elif __SIMD__ */ - - /************************* COMMON STUFF BELOW *************************/ --- -2.14.1 - diff --git a/package/aircrack-ng/0001-autotools-Fix-optional-SIMD-on-PPC-arch.patch b/package/aircrack-ng/0001-autotools-Fix-optional-SIMD-on-PPC-arch.patch deleted file mode 100644 index 11568525e8..0000000000 --- a/package/aircrack-ng/0001-autotools-Fix-optional-SIMD-on-PPC-arch.patch +++ /dev/null @@ -1,69 +0,0 @@ -From 7cf680386de051cb8308510680299aef810fe743 Mon Sep 17 00:00:00 2001 -From: Joseph Benden -Date: Fri, 17 Aug 2018 13:23:39 -0700 -Subject: [PATCH] autotools: Fix optional SIMD on PPC arch - -Resolves: -https://github.com/aircrack-ng/aircrack-ng/issues/1941 - -Upstream (applied to their master, not yet in a release): (squashed together) -https://github.com/aircrack-ng/aircrack-ng/commit/97838c6b903d33c8403a4bdcae60b8619fad7538 -https://github.com/aircrack-ng/aircrack-ng/commit/efc0b2718f4afd9582419902d205b242e546b9ab - -Signed-off-by: Joseph Benden -Signed-off-by: Matt Weber